SPLC Indicted on 11 Fraud Counts, $3 M Alleged Transfer
4/24/2026
1 of 2
Story summary
- Acting Attorney General Todd Blanche announced an Alabama jury indicted the Southern Poverty Law Center (SPLC) on 11 fraud and money-laundering counts.
- Prosecutors allege the SPLC funneled over $3 million to extremist-group members through a program and hid money in accounts of Fox Photography and Rare Books Warehouse.
- SPLC interim CEO Bryan Fair called the charges false, accused the Justice Department of weaponizing the legal system, and pledged a vigorous defense.
